Why do my drains smell like pee?

Why does my drain smell of urine? If a drain is emitting a strong urine smell, then a faulty toilet seal or mould problem could be the reason. Faulty Toilet Seal: Every toilet should have an effective seal ring. Should this be faulty or missing, this could result in the lingering urine smell.

Why do I have sewer smell coming from shower drain?

Smells in a shower drain can be caused by odor-causing bacteria that feed on debris in the pipe. Some of these anaerobic bacteria live in fetid water in the P-trap and produce hydrogen sulfide gas, which smells like sewage. Other odors can also be caused by the debris itself, like hair or soap scum build-up.

How do you get rid of sewer gas smell in bathroom?

  1. Pour 1/4 cup of baking soda into the drain.
  2. Follow with one cup of white vinegar.
  3. Let that sit for two hours with the bathroom door closed.
  4. Slowly pour a gallon of hot water down the drain.
  5. After 15 minutes, run cold water for 10 minutes to thoroughly rinse the vinegar down.

Why do my sinks smell like sewer?

If your kitchen sink drain smells, especially if there is a sewer smell, you may have a dry P-trap. … There needs to be water in the P-trap at all times. There may also be a drain pipe or vent problem. This could involve pipe damage or an obstruction in your vent.

Is it bad if your pee smells really strong?

When you’re dehydrated and your pee gets very concentrated, it can smell strongly of ammonia. If you catch a whiff of something really strong before you flush, it might also be a sign of a UTI, diabetes, a bladder infection, or metabolic diseases.
